SEMBLANCE
An abundance of unforeseen good and evil...
I witness hatred and ignorance occupy minds
Semblance created to facilitate lies
Our brothers and sisters have been alienated and died
Though radiating in powerful potential
Others degrade, striving to terminate the culture
Nothing short of despisement
Choices built on a foundation of fear as opposed to optimism
Carrying the complexity of a burden bestowed upon me
Little justification of false accusations
Then transcending into admiration subsequently relocated of displacement
Viewed as naturally disobedient, from the adversary turned ally
This very presence has disturbed a twisted peace, Undoubtedly a non sequitur
Racism, Eracism vacillating
Feet no longer held above the fire, yet the burns and scars still inspire
Infinitesimal luminescence attempting to pierce through darkness
A revolution slowly beginning to commence
Examined from the face up; skin up
Misguided influence penetrating young morsel minds
Desecrating the image of innocent ebony beings
Genocism and nicknames distorting God's children's frames
Uttermost loathing in the absence of warrant
The system is quite amusing when dissected for viewing
To imitate would be suicide, but to conform and abide would be silly
right?
The sting of death is sin, and the power of sin is the law
No longer chained up now, FREE, universal gratuity to a Eagle
These very words might appear as fecal
Nonetheless, I pray that one day there will never be a sequel
And others shall not shelter their eyes but, see as we do...
